A union type representing all possible values for both KeyVaultPermission.dataActions and KeyVaultPermission.notDataActions.
A scope of the role assignment or definition. The valid scopes are: "/", "/keys" and any a specific resource Id followed by a slash, as in "ID/".
Supported API versions
The latest supported Key Vault service API version.
Current version of the Key Vault Admin SDK.
The @azure/logger configuration for this package.
Creates a new ChallengeBasedAuthenticationPolicy factory.
The TokenCredential implementation that can supply the challenge token.
Generates a version of the state with only public properties. At least those common for all of the Key Vault Admin pollers.
Creates a span using the tracer that was set by the user
The name of the method creating the span.
Parses an WWW-Authenticate response.
This transforms a string value like:
Bearer authorization="some_authorization", resource="https://some.url"
into an object like:
{ authorization: "some_authorization", resource: "https://some.url" }
String value in the WWW-Authenticate header
Returns updated HTTP options with the given span as the parent of future spans, if applicable.
The span for the current operation.
The options for the underlying HTTP request.
Generated using TypeDoc
An interface representing the publicly available properties of the state of a backup Key Vault's poll operation.